Abstract: The dynamics of secondary, anisotropic coherent structures behaving as a stationary wave, including zonal/mean flows, streamers and low-frequency long wavelength fluctuations, in multiple-scale turbulence in tokamak plasmas is investigated by performing 3D simulations as well as 2D modeling analyses. The role of nonlinear mode coupling is specifically discussed as a ubiquitous principal interaction mechanism in the dual processes of the generation and back-action of secondary structures on ITG and ETG turbulence.
